Fast Starts, Fierce Lessons: WRA Runs Bold at Gilmour Invitational

The story of Saturday's Gilmour Academy Paul Primeau Invitational was not measured by place or podium, but by intent. With the schedule calling for three races packed into eight days, the WRA boys arrived in Gates Mills with a different experiment in mind: commit to a fast first mile, lean into discomfort, and see who might emerge when the pace demanded courage. On a course known for its sharp turns and hidden climbs, that strategy produced a mix of breakthroughs, lessons, and confidence heading into the next test.

Junior James Johnston '27 delivered the boldest statement. He surged to the front with a 5:00-flat opening mile, holding the lead for more than two miles. His second-place finish in 17:01.7 was less about the result and more about the way he chose to race—pushing his pace from the start and carrying the lead for more than two miles. In doing so, Johnston not only met the day's objective but continued to raise his ceiling.

Sophomore Brendan Bennett '28 followed with a 17:58.9, placing sixth overall and among the top two underclassmen, reinforcing his place as a steady presence the program can count on for top-10 finishes. Senior Rian Arora '26 showed new reserves of strength with a 19:27.9, a performance that impressed his coaches. Junior Daniel Randazzo '27 (19:55.5) ran a controlled but ambitious 5:45 first mile, sharpening his racing instincts for that crucial opening stretch.

In the chase pack, junior Leo Wang '27 overcame a sleepless night to post 20:22.3, finishing shoulder-to-shoulder with senior Grant Adams '26 (20:22.4), who opened with a confident 5:52. Sophomores Arav Mather '28 (20:31.8), Ronan Flowers '28 (21:57.4), and junior Wen Xiao '27 (22:32.6) closed out the varsity effort, providing essential depth and experience.

The JV squad added its own momentum to the day. Sophomore Harry Xu '28 impressed in his WRA XC debut, running a 22:20.3 PR to lead the group. Behind him, freshman Maverick Geraghty '29 (23:06.1) ran a confident and strong race, while seniors Shane Deng '26 (24:21.8 PR) and Tristan Karhl '26 (24:28.2 PR) each turned in standout improvements on a course that rarely gives away fast times. Sophomore Tyler Omega '28 (23:59.1) continued his steady upward climb.

Other notable moments included freshman Phineas Haskell '29 (24:30.5), who raced tough even while learning the subtler art of pre-race nutrition. Juniors Alex Wang '27 (28:00.6 PR) and Kendel Barber '28 (30:19.2 PR) each showing tremendous grit in the final mile. Freshman Peter Qin '29 (27:53.3) marked his WRA debut with a personal best. Sophomore Justin Yin '28 (30:17.5) also launched his season, laying groundwork for the weeks ahead.

The takeaway from Gilmour was not about the finish order but about the mindset: racing with purpose and embracing the uncomfortable work that builds successful seasons. The boys accomplished their goal. Now they turn quickly to the next meet, carrying with them the momentum of a fast first mile and the conviction that tomorrow brings another chance to push the limits.
